How Dianex 50mg Tablet works:
Dianex 50mg tablets stimulate the production of proteoglycans, thus promoting cartilage regeneration in joints. This action facilitates joint repair while concurrently reducing pain and inflammation.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Use caution when combining Dianex 50mg tablets with alcohol. Seek medical advice before doing so.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Dianex 50m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ice before using this medication.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Dianex 50m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icate pot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The effect of Dianex 50mg Tablet on driving ability is undetermined. Refrain from driving if you experience sym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Use of Dianex 50mg Tablets in individuals with kidney disease appears to pose minimal risk. Current ev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with severe hepatic impairment should use Dianex 50m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Physician consultation is advised.
What if you forget to take Dianex 50mg Tablet :
Omit any missed Dianex 50mg Tablet d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
